My Buying Guides on Tom Kha Gai Paste

What I Look For in Tom Kha Gai Paste

When I buy Tom Kha Gai paste, I first check the ingredient list. I want a paste that includes the key Thai flavors I expect: lemongrass, galangal, kaffir lime, chili, and shallots. If I see too many fillers, preservatives, or artificial flavors, I usually skip it. For me, a good paste should taste fresh, aromatic, and balanced.

How I Judge the Flavor

My biggest concern is flavor balance. Tom Kha Gai should be creamy, tangy, slightly spicy, and fragrant. I prefer a paste that gives me a rich coconut-soup base without being too salty or too sour. If possible, I read reviews to see whether other buyers found it authentic and easy to adjust to their taste.

Ingredients I Prefer

I usually choose a paste with natural ingredients and minimal additives. I like it when the product uses real herbs and spices instead of artificial substitutes. If I can find a paste that is gluten-free, vegan-friendly, or free from MSG, that is even better for my needs. I also pay attention to whether the paste contains shrimp or fish ingredients, especially if I am cooking for someone with dietary restrictions.

Packaging and Shelf Life

I always check the packaging before buying. A sealed jar, pouch, or tub that is easy to store works best for me. I also look at the expiration date because I want enough time to use the paste after opening. Since I may not use it every week, I prefer packaging that keeps the paste fresh in the refrigerator.

Heat Level and Customization

I like a paste that gives me control over the spice level. Some brands are very mild, while others are quite hot. I usually start with a smaller amount and add more if needed. That way, I can make the soup suitable for my own taste or for guests who may not enjoy too much heat.

Brand Reputation and Reviews

Before I buy, I often look at the brand’s reputation. I trust brands that are known for Thai or Asian cooking products because they usually understand the flavor profile better. Customer reviews also help me decide whether the paste is worth trying. If many people mention strong aroma, authentic taste, and good value, I feel more confident buying it.

Price and Value

I compare the price with the amount I get. Sometimes a slightly more expensive paste is worth it if the flavor is better and I need less of it per dish. I try to find a product that gives me good value without sacrificing quality. For me, the cheapest option is not always the best choice.

How I Use Tom Kha Gai Paste

I like a paste that is versatile and easy to use. I usually mix it with coconut milk, broth, chicken, mushrooms, and lime juice to make the soup. If the paste is strong, I can stretch it into more servings. I also appreciate when it works well in other dishes like stir-fries, marinades, or noodle soups.

My Final Buying Tip

When I choose Tom Kha Gai paste, I focus on authenticity, ingredient quality, and taste balance. My best advice is to start with a trusted brand and a small jar or pouch first. That way, I can test the flavor and decide whether it fits my cooking style before buying more.
